Police in Anambra State, South-East Nigeria, have said they working towards achieving a violent free election in the November 6, 2021 governorship contests.

The Commissioner of Police, Tony Olofu, at separate meetings with the representatives of political parties as well as the Farmers and Herders Committee, appealed for more support from key players in order to achieve peaceful coexistence among the people.

At the meeting held at the Command Headquarters, CP Olofu appealed for orderliness especially as the parties embark on their final campaigns.

In a separate meeting with the Farmers and Herders Committee, the Police Commissioner urged residents to live in peace and harmony, hinting that no meaningful development can be achieved in a hostile environment.

He reminded his audience that ensuring there is security was the responsibility of everybody and as such all hands must be on deck to achieve an Anambra State that is free of crime, as well as a violent free election, come November 6, 2021.
